Neuhausen-Nymphenburg, Deutschland - on July 4, 2025, the Munich traffic situation unfortunately cannot be described as brilliant. On Landshuter Allee, an important traffic route towards Mittlerer Ring, there was an incident with victims of the vehicles. This has led to considerable restrictions in the road network. How News.de reports, the affected area is about 3.2 km long, starting between B2R, the Landshuter Allee tunnel and Grüntenstraße. The road has narrowed on two lanes, which also exacerbates the situation.

The current traffic restrictions start from 7:34 p.m. to 11:34 p.m., which can lead to storming traffic and sporadic traffic jams. Drivers should therefore pay particular attention to the local signage in order to be able to orient themselves better.
